Located at the foot of Mt Ainslie, Campbell is a lovely tree-lined suburb and within walking distance to the city. The local shops are just around the corner. A walk up Mt Ainslie will reward you with a stunning vista of Canberra and the surrounding mountains. Lake Burley Griffin is only a ten minute walk away. From there it's possible to walk around the foreshore to a number of National museums including National Gallery, National Library, Old Parliament House and others. Canberra is a bike friendly city and dedicated bike paths are within minutes away. Electric scooters are easily found and fun to try. Nearby Constitution Avenue is a major transport route and buses are frequent. There is also a bus stop on Blamey Crescent going to the city. The airport is less than 10 minutes away by car or Uber and costs $25 or less. Bus route R3 runs to and from the airport every 30 minutes (nearest bus stop on Constitution Ave/Blamey Crescent). You’ll find everything you need at the Campbell Shops, less than a five minute walk, around the corner on Blamey Crescent: post office, IGA supermarket, chemist, bottle shop, bakery, cafe and two restaurants as well as a doctor's surgery, hairdresser, dry cleaners and dentist. There’s a bus stop to the city opposite the Shops. You’ll find more places to dine on Constitution Ave, a ten minute walk away.
